В openvswitch есть такая интересная штука, как присвоение каждому номеру порта своего vlan'а. Делается на коммутаторе это так:
ovs-vsctl add-port br-lan0 swp0 tag=10
ovs-vsctl add-port br-lan0 swp1 tag=11
ip link add link eth0 name ivrn0 type vlan id 10
ip link add link eth0 name mts0 type vlan id 11